Transaction 803617754abd617d2d05eaf2f275c494c835d2fd0e8069a66ab85aecd8e46b26
1 Input
2 Outputs
- 803617754abd617d2d05eaf2f275c494c835d2fd0e8069a66ab85aecd8e46b26:0
- 803617754abd617d2d05eaf2f275c494c835d2fd0e8069a66ab85aecd8e46b26:1
value 621509
address 17Q9NDy5fTpyK3Ln6WumXhZHmDW4UGfC8b
value 99338159
address 38uo2NxVfzrUwD9pAydcm5M7yat7jAhm16